The Galaxy S25 Ultra, Samsung's next-generation flagship smartphone, is expected to be launched in January next year. Ahead of the launch, the phone appeared in what seems to be a legit hands-on video showcasing its stunning design.

Galaxy S25 Ultra flaunts its curved edges

A video appeared on Reddit that reportedly showcases the Galaxy S25 Ultra. The phone seems to have curved corners, unlike the Galaxy S24 Ultra. It also appears to feature a mid-frame that curves slightly towards the rear.

The combination of curved corners and the curved middle frame will offer hugely improved ergonomics and comfort. If this video features a legit Galaxy S25 Ultra, you should expect a more comfortable-feeling phone than previous Galaxy S Ultra devices.

 

The phone has flat metal sides and very thin, uniform bezels around the screen. The power and volume buttons are on the right side of the phone, while the rear has four cameras, featuring a periscope-style lens for its super telephoto camera.

Galaxy S25 Ultra leaked specifications

Previous reports indicated that the Galaxy S25 Ultra will have a 6.8-inch Dynamic AMOLED 2x screen.

It will likely have a 12MP selfie camera, a 200MP primary rear camera, a 50MP telephoto camera (5x optical zoom), a 50MP ultrawide camera, and a 10MP telephoto camera (3x optical zoom).

The device will likely run Android 15-based One UI 7 out of the box and get seven additional major Android updates.

Reports claim that the Galaxy S25 Ultra will use the Snapdragon 8 Elite chip globally. It will have 12GB/16GB RAM and 256GB/512GB/1TB storage.

Other features could include an IP68 rating, stereo speakers, and a 5,000mAh battery. It could have 45W fast charging and 15W wireless fast charging.
